12 valves. Up to 48 valve controllers can be centrally controlled as CAN slaves by the HE 5760. The valves are assigned to so- called filter chambers. The control is set to the existing number of chambers and valves using the parameter menu.

Each device in the CAN network is addressed with its CAN node number. The assignment of the CAN addresses must comply with certain rules. The HE 5760 control unit does not require a CAN address. With the HE 5725 valve controls, a distinction is made between: ...

ESC = Back 8.5 Communication structure The HE 5760 central control unit is the master in the system CAN bus of the filter control system. A Profibus or a Modbus RTU interface is optionally available for the control technology. dp or the system pressure can be sent from the control technology.

The pause time is calculated by a PID control algorithm. Very large pause times are calculated, especially with low differential pressure. The value 'Maximum pause' limits the output value. Differential pressure is a reference variable. Pause time is output variable. Pause extension HE 5760 Operating Instructions # 372449| Version 3.2...

Definition / Explanation Operating mode, Permanent processing of the parameterised valve sequence. permanent Control of the HE 5760 via start/stop signals. Operating mode, dp It can be regulated to a differential pressure value. The output controller variable of the controller is the pause time of the valve activation.
